About the role
Role DescriptionWe are looking for an organized, hands-on, and results-oriented Warehouse Manager to oversee daily warehouse operations and ensure the efficient, accurate, and safe handling of inventory. The role is responsible for coordinating receiving, storage, picking, packing, dispatch, inventory control, and warehouse processes while maintaining high standards of productivity, accuracy, and service quality.Key responsibilities include planning and coordinating daily warehouse activities, allocating manpower and resources, monitoring inventory movements, and ensuring accurate receiving and dispatch procedures. The Warehouse Manager will supervise warehouse operations, monitor team performance, maintain effective workflows, and ensure compliance with company policies, safety standards, and operational procedures.The role also involves conducting inventory checks, investigating stock discrepancies, optimizing warehouse layouts and processes, and identifying opportunities to improve productivity and cost efficiency. The successful candidate will work closely with procurement, logistics, sales, finance, and other teams to ensure timely order fulfillment, accurate inventory records, and smooth supply chain operations.QualificationsStrong understanding of warehouse operations, inventory management, logistics, and supply chain processes.Knowledge of receiving, storage, picking, packing, dispatch, stock control, and order fulfillment.Ability to plan and coordinate warehouse activities and effectively allocate manpower and resources.Strong inventory control and reconciliation skills with excellent attention to accuracy.Familiarity with Warehouse Management Systems (WMS), ERP platforms, barcode systems, or inventory management software.Good understanding of warehouse safety, equipment handling, storage standards, and workplace procedures.Strong leadership, team coordination, communication, and problem-solving skills.Ability to monitor operational KPIs, analyze performance, and implement process improvements.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and other tools for inventory tracking and operational reporting.Strong organizational and time-management sk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ities.Ability to respond effectively to operational issues and unexpected changes.Proactive and practical mindset with a strong focus on efficiency, accuracy, safety, cost control, and continuous improvement.High level of accountability, reliability, and attention to detail.
